As for a definition of space rock, I guess it depends on who you ask, but for me it's typified by Hawkwind, early Pink Floyd etc. Drifty, epic, synth-driven prog/psych, at it's best when wrapped in some sort of post-'2001' hippy-dippy space theme. There's arguably a pretty significant crossover between space rock and some kosmische music (e.g. the Cosmic Jokers).
